Frequently Asked Questions About Junk Removal in Goodfellow AFB

Common questions about junk removal services in Goodfellow AFB, Texas

How does living on Goodfellow AFB affect junk removal scheduling and access?

As Goodfellow AFB is an active military installation, junk removal services require coordination with base security and housing offices. Most providers serving the area are familiar with base access procedures, but appointments often need to be scheduled in advance to accommodate gate clearance and specific base housing rules. You'll typically need to be present to grant access, and providers must follow strict guidelines regarding vehicle identification and on-base conduct. It's recommended to use companies experienced with military base removals in the San Angelo area.

What are the specific rules for disposing of electronics (e-waste) from Goodfellow AFB housing?

Due to security protocols and Texas state regulations, electronics disposal from base housing has specific requirements. Items like old computers, monitors, or communication equipment may contain sensitive data and must be handled properly. Many junk removal services in the San Angelo/Goodfellow area partner with certified e-waste recyclers. However, for military-issued electronics, you must follow base IT disposal procedures first. For personal electronics, ensure your chosen service provides documentation of certified recycling to comply with both base and Texas Commission on Environmental Quality (TCEQ) rules.

Can junk removal services help with frequent PCS (Permanent Change of Station) move-outs in Goodfellow AFB housing?

Yes, local junk removal companies are highly experienced with PCS clean-outs, which are common in Goodfellow AFB. They can efficiently handle unwanted furniture, household goods, and debris left behind during rushed transitions. Many offer same-day or next-day service to meet tight moving timelines. Services often include a thorough sweep of the residence to ensure it meets base housing inspection standards. It's advisable to schedule as soon as your move date is confirmed, especially during peak PCS seasons (summer and early winter).

Are there restrictions on removing large items like old appliances or furniture from base housing quarters?

Yes, Goodfellow AFB housing has specific guidelines for large item removal. Appliances (refrigerators, washers, etc.) provided as government-furnished property cannot be removed by a third-party service without prior authorization from the housing office. For personal large items, removal is generally allowed, but you must ensure the service truck can access your housing area and that items are placed curbside only on designated pickup days, if applicable. Some housing areas may have bulk trash collection schedules that junk removal services can work around. Always check with your housing management office first.

What local disposal facilities do junk removal services near Goodfellow AFB use, and are there city-specific fees?

Junk removal services serving Goodfellow AFB typically use the City of San Angelo's landfill or transfer stations, such as the PaulAnn Facility. Disposal costs include city landfill fees and Texas state-mandated charges. For San Angelo residents (and by extension, base personnel), certain items like tires, mattresses, or electronics may incur additional special disposal fees. Reputable services will provide transparent pricing that includes these local costs. Note that some items collected on base may be subject to separate recycling programs at the San Angelo Material Recovery Facility (MRF).

Your Guide to Hot Tub Removal at Goodfellow AFB: Local Tips for a Smooth Process

Expert insights on hot tub removal in Goodfellow AFB, Texas

If you're stationed at Goodfellow AFB or living nearby and have an old, unused hot tub taking up space, you're not alone. Many military families and local residents face the challenge of removing these bulky items. Hot tub removal in the Goodfellow AFB area requires some specific planning, especially given our West Texas location and base housing regulations. This guide will walk you through your options and local considerations to make the process as smooth as possible.

Understanding Your Removal Options

First, assess your hot tub's condition. If it's still functional, consider listing it for free or low cost on local platforms like the Goodfellow AFB community Facebook pages or San Angelo online marketplaces—someone might be willing to haul it away for parts or repair. For non-working units, you have two main paths: DIY removal or hiring a professional junk removal service. DIY involves draining completely (never onto base lawns due to water restrictions), disconnecting power, and breaking down the tub with tools, which is labor-intensive. Professional services handle everything from disconnection to disposal, saving you time and effort.

Local Considerations for Goodfellow AFB Residents

Living on or near the base adds unique layers. If you're in base housing, always check with housing management first—there may be specific rules about large item removal, disposal sites, or required permits to avoid fines. For off-base residents in San Angelo, follow city bulk trash pickup guidelines, but note hot tubs often exceed size limits. Our arid climate means drainage is critical; avoid letting water pool to prevent mosquito breeding. Also, the hard caliche soil common here can make dragging a heavy tub tricky, so plan for extra manpower or equipment.

Choosing a Local Junk Removal Service

When hiring help, look for companies familiar with Goodfellow AFB and San Angelo. They'll understand base access procedures if needed and know local disposal facilities, like the city landfill or recycling centers. Ask about eco-friendly disposal—some parts like acrylic shells or metal frames can be recycled. Get multiple quotes, as prices can vary based on tub size and accessibility. A reputable service should handle all heavy lifting, which is a huge relief in our Texas heat.

Actionable Tips for a Successful Removal

1. **Prepare in Advance**: Drain the tub over several hours using a submersible pump, directing water to a sanitary sewer drain (not storm drains).

2. **Clear Access**: Move patio furniture or debris from the path to your curb or driveway to speed up the process.

3. **Check for Rebates**: Some local utilities or recycling programs offer incentives for removing old appliances—worth a quick call.

4. **Time It Right**: Schedule removal during milder seasons; summer afternoons here can be brutally hot for heavy work.

Removing a hot tub can free up valuable outdoor space for new memories—whether it's a play area for kids or a simpler patio setup. By planning ahead and using local resources, you can tackle this project efficiently and get back to enjoying life in the Goodfellow community.
